Understanding the Ussuri's Temperament
The Ussuri is a truly unique and wild-looking cat, characterized by a temperament that balances strong independence with a need for active engagement. With an energy level of 4 out of 5 and exercise needs also at 4 out of 5, these cats are far from sedentary. They are inherently Active, constantly seeking outlets for their robust energy and strong hunting instincts. Owners can expect a companion that thrives on regular play sessions, climbing, and exploring its environment. Their Alert nature means they are keenly aware of their surroundings, missing little and often observing with a watchful intensity. While intelligent and observant, the Ussuri is also Reserved, not typically seeking constant human interaction or being overly demonstrative with affection. This isn't to say they don't form bonds, but rather they appreciate space and quiet, preferring to interact on their own terms. Finally, their Hardy nature speaks to their resilience and adaptability, particularly in cooler climates, as indicated by their 'cold' climate preference. Daily life with an Ussuri involves providing ample mental and physical stimulation, respecting their independent streak, and appreciating a companion that is watchful, self-sufficient, and deeply connected to its natural instincts.
